What is the lifespan of an elephant?

Answer
VerifiedVerified
421.5k+ views
like imagedislike image
Hint: The time between an organism's birth and death is referred to as its life span. It is a well-known fact that all living things die. Some have a brief lifetime, such as the mayfly, whose adult life lasts only a day, while others, such as the twisted bristlecone pines, survive for thousands of years. The limitations of each species' life span appear to be set in the end by genetics.

Complete answer:
Elephants are famous for their magnificent size and strength, as well as their lengthy lifespans. Elephants, with the exception of humans, live longer than any other terrestrial animal. Unfortunately, elephants' life spans are affected by a variety of variables, both in captivity and in the wild, and people play a significant role in this.
Elephants in the wild can live up to 70 years. In the wild, African elephants live an average of 56 years, whereas Asian elephants live an average of 41.7 years. Poaching or illegal hunting for ivory or other purposes, habitat loss, and drought all contribute to a shortened life span.
Furthermore, elephants living in captivity tend to have a shorter lifespan due to the stress of living in captivity.

Note:
Life expectancy and life span are frequently used to describe the life cycle of any animal. While both phrases refer to the amount of years one can live, they really refer to two distinct ideas. While life expectancy refers to an estimate or average number of years a person might anticipate to live, longevity refers to the maximum number of years an individual can live.
